Abstrakt

The aim of our work was to create a complex screening system for assessing influences of prevention, prophylaxis and biosecurity practices on reducing usage of antimicrobial substances and AMR developing. We resulted from a professional literature (PubMed, Web of Science) especially the practical experience of the authors. The decision to use antimicrobials to treat humans and animals must be based on the veterinarian’s correct diagnosis, identifying the causative agent and therapy designing based on laboratory confirmation of antimicrobial susceptibility. Under no circumstances may antimicrobials in livestock farms be used to compensate for low hygiene, shortcomings in the work of management, zootechnics and caretakers.
